Procedural Posture

Application Under Section 271 Companies Act 1993 (pooling Order) / Judgment on Unopposed Application (hearing 14 Sep 2009; Judgment 16 Sep 2009)

  1. 1 Whether it is just and equitable to order that the liquidations of related companies proceed together under s.271(1)(b) Companies Act 1993
  2. 2 Whether service requirements under s.271A were met
  3. 3 Effect of pooling on secured, preferential and unsecured creditors

Ratio Decidendi

Given the companies were related and their affairs were so intermingled—common management and staff, pooled banking and cash flows, inter-company lending and guarantees, and inability to segregate records or run separate liquidations—and statutory service requirements were satisfied, it was just and equitable under s.271(1)(b) to order the liquidations to proceed together while preserving secured creditors' rights and preferential priorities and treating unsecured claims to rank equally.

Court Disposition

Application granted: pooling order made under s.271(1)(b) Companies Act 1993; costs reserved

Orders

  • The liquidations of each of the respondent companies are to proceed together as if they were one company.
  • Nothing in the pooling order affects the rights of any secured creditor of any of the respondent companies.
